General Scheduling Reminders (Continued) THECB Link for Course Inventory: http://www.thecb.state.tx.us/ Web Assist Classes: If you are having trouble deleting current sections, please enter the DD on SZAREGS, then record remove coursefor each student then continue with deletion in SSASECT.Special Topics: Hybrid/Blended Course: A course in which at least 50%, but less than 85% of the planned instruction occurswhen the students and instructor(s) are not in the same place.All Hybrid Courses must be approved by the Office of Distance Learning. No Exceptions.Hybrid sections should be coded with a “Y” in the section number (i.e.: Y01, Y02)Deleting sections during Administrative Cleanup periods: Please do not confuse Web assist with Hybrid. Web assist does not need approval because it is not an instruction mode.It is still a 100% Face to Face class, but the instructor may post items such as a syllabus or homework assignments onthe web for students to access. However, the class still meets for the full amount of contact hours as outlined by theTexas Higher Education Coordinating Board (THECB).Hybrid Sections: Click on Data Resources and Tools, then click on Institution and Researchers, then Course and Program Inventoriesthen University Course Inventory, then choose Prairie View A&M University and choose excel this will give you thelist of courses for the University.Please do not send memos please use the Special Topics Form that has been provided to you for processingFirst time offered sub-titles for Special Topic Courses must be approved by Academic Affairs and received by theRegistrar’s office by filling out the Special Topics Form before a section for that sub-title is built. After initial setup ofthe subtitles all future request must go directly to the registrar’s office.The Schedule Coordinator will build and notify the department when sub-title has been added to SCACRSE and thesection has been built.State Rule/Time Limit on Special Topics Course Offering- If topic is offered 3 times in 5 years the topic will bedeactivated. The Department must go through UAC to create the topic as a course.Blocked Schedule Update : Fridays are no longer blocked between the hours of 2pm – 4pm.
